DeptUserEntity.java 4.3 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181
  1. package cn.com.lzt.userstats.enitity;
  2. import java.math.BigDecimal;
  3. import java.util.Date;
  4. import java.util.List;
  5. import java.lang.String;
  6. import java.lang.Double;
  7. import java.lang.Integer;
  8. import java.math.BigDecimal;
  9. import javax.xml.soap.Text;
  10. import java.sql.Blob;
  11. import javax.persistence.Column;
  12. import javax.persistence.Entity;
  13. import javax.persistence.GeneratedValue;
  14. import javax.persistence.GenerationType;
  15. import javax.persistence.Id;
  16. import javax.persistence.Table;
  17. import org.hibernate.annotations.GenericGenerator;
  18. import javax.persistence.SequenceGenerator;
  19. import org.jeecgframework.poi.excel.annotation.Excel;
  20. /**
  21. * @Title: Entity
  22. * @Description: 部门工资统计表
  23. * @author onlineGenerator
  24. * @date 2017-10-24 16:38:50
  25. * @version V1.0
  26. *
  27. */
  28. @Entity
  29. @Table(name = "t_bus_dept_user_statistics", schema = "")
  30. @SuppressWarnings("serial")
  31. public class DeptUserEntity implements java.io.Serializable {
  32. /**主键*/
  33. private java.lang.String id;
  34. @Excel(name="年月",width=15,format = "yyyy-MM-dd")
  35. private java.lang.String yearmonth;
  36. @Excel(name="项目id",width=15)
  37. private java.lang.String pjtId;
  38. @Excel(name="项目经理id",width=15)
  39. private java.lang.String pmId;
  40. @Excel(name="部门id",width=15)
  41. private String deptId;
  42. @Excel(name="月初总人数",width=15)
  43. private Integer earlymonthTotal;
  44. @Excel(name="入职人数",width=15)
  45. private Integer entryTotal;
  46. @Excel(name="离职人数",width=15)
  47. private Integer leaveTotal;
  48. @Excel(name="调出人数",width=15)
  49. private Integer calloutTotal;
  50. @Excel(name="调入人数",width=15)
  51. private Integer callinTotal;
  52. @Excel(name="月未总人数",width=15)
  53. private Integer endmonthTotal;
  54. @Excel(name="员工流动比例",width=15)
  55. private BigDecimal flowProportion;
  56. /**
  57. *方法: 取得java.lang.String
  58. *@return: java.lang.String 主键
  59. */
  60. @Id
  61. @GeneratedValue(generator = "paymentableGenerator")
  62. @GenericGenerator(name = "paymentableGenerator", strategy = "uuid")
  63. @Column(name ="ID",nullable=false,length=36)
  64. public java.lang.String getId(){
  65. return this.id;
  66. }
  67. /**
  68. *方法: 设置java.lang.String
  69. *@param: java.lang.String 主键
  70. */
  71. public void setId(java.lang.String id){
  72. this.id = id;
  73. }
  74. @Column(name ="YEARMONTH",nullable=true,length=50)
  75. public java.lang.String getYearmonth() {
  76. return yearmonth;
  77. }
  78. public void setYearmonth(java.lang.String yearmonth) {
  79. this.yearmonth = yearmonth;
  80. }
  81. @Column(name ="PJT_ID",nullable=true,length=50)
  82. public java.lang.String getPjtId() {
  83. return pjtId;
  84. }
  85. public void setPjtId(java.lang.String pjtId) {
  86. this.pjtId = pjtId;
  87. }
  88. @Column(name ="PM_ID",nullable=true,length=50)
  89. public java.lang.String getPmId() {
  90. return pmId;
  91. }
  92. public void setPmId(java.lang.String pmId) {
  93. this.pmId = pmId;
  94. }
  95. @Column(name ="DEPT_ID",nullable=true,length=50)
  96. public String getDeptId() {
  97. return deptId;
  98. }
  99. public void setDeptId(String deptId) {
  100. this.deptId = deptId;
  101. }
  102. @Column(name ="EARLYMONTH_TOTAL",nullable=true,length=50)
  103. public Integer getEarlymonthTotal() {
  104. return earlymonthTotal;
  105. }
  106. public void setEarlymonthTotal(Integer earlymonthTotal) {
  107. this.earlymonthTotal = earlymonthTotal;
  108. }
  109. @Column(name ="ENTRY_TOTAL",nullable=true,length=50)
  110. public Integer getEntryTotal() {
  111. return entryTotal;
  112. }
  113. public void setEntryTotal(Integer entryTotal) {
  114. this.entryTotal = entryTotal;
  115. }
  116. @Column(name ="LEAVE_TOTAL",nullable=true,length=50)
  117. public Integer getLeaveTotal() {
  118. return leaveTotal;
  119. }
  120. public void setLeaveTotal(Integer leaveTotal) {
  121. this.leaveTotal = leaveTotal;
  122. }
  123. @Column(name ="CALLOUT_TOTAL",nullable=true,length=50)
  124. public Integer getCalloutTotal() {
  125. return calloutTotal;
  126. }
  127. public void setCalloutTotal(Integer calloutTotal) {
  128. this.calloutTotal = calloutTotal;
  129. }
  130. @Column(name ="CALLIN_TOTAL",nullable=true,length=50)
  131. public Integer getCallinTotal() {
  132. return callinTotal;
  133. }
  134. public void setCallinTotal(Integer callinTotal) {
  135. this.callinTotal = callinTotal;
  136. }
  137. @Column(name ="ENDMONTH_TOTAL",nullable=true,length=50)
  138. public Integer getEndmonthTotal() {
  139. return endmonthTotal;
  140. }
  141. public void setEndmonthTotal(Integer endmonthTotal) {
  142. this.endmonthTotal = endmonthTotal;
  143. }
  144. @Column(name ="FLOW_PROPORTION",nullable=true,length=50)
  145. public BigDecimal getFlowProportion() {
  146. return flowProportion;
  147. }
  148. public void setFlowProportion(BigDecimal flowProportion) {
  149. this.flowProportion = flowProportion;
  150. }
  151. }